diff options
Diffstat (limited to 'app/src/main/java/de/blinkt/openvpn/core/LogItem.java')
-rw-r--r-- | app/src/main/java/de/blinkt/openvpn/core/LogItem.java |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/app/src/main/java/de/blinkt/openvpn/core/LogItem.java b/app/src/main/java/de/blinkt/openvpn/core/LogItem.java index 178906c3..8a0a528a 100644 --- a/app/src/main/java/de/blinkt/openvpn/core/LogItem.java +++ b/app/src/main/java/de/blinkt/openvpn/core/LogItem.java @@ -39,6 +39,7 @@ public class LogItem implements Parcelable { private int mRessourceId; // Default log priority VpnStatus.LogLevel mLevel = VpnStatus.LogLevel.INFO; + private VpnStatus.ErrorType errorType = VpnStatus.ErrorType.UNKNOWN; private long logtime = System.currentTimeMillis(); private int mVerbosityLevel = -1; @@ -246,6 +247,11 @@ public class LogItem implements Parcelable { mLevel = loglevel; } + public LogItem(VpnStatus.ErrorType errorType) { + mLevel = VpnStatus.LogLevel.ERROR; + this.errorType = errorType; + } + public String getString(Context c) { try { if (mMessage != null) { @@ -306,6 +312,10 @@ public class LogItem implements Parcelable { return mLevel; } + public VpnStatus.ErrorType getErrorType() { + return errorType; + } + @Override public String toString() { |